Summary     : Tools for AppData files
Description :
appdata-tools contains a command line program designed to validate AppData
application descriptions for standards compliance and to the style guide.

Update Information:

- New upstream release
- Add a style rule to require 300 chars of <p> content before <ul>
- Add an --output-format parameter that can optionally output HTML or XML
- Allow GFDL as an acceptable content licence
- Generate appdata.rng from appdata.rnc at build time
- Host an online version of the AppData validation tool
- Install included RELAX NG schema and make it automatically loadable by Emacs
- Support the 'codec' AppData kind
- Validate AppData files with metadata keys
